Fame Slept Here

72 EAST 3rd STREET
The Facts: Two-bedroom, two-bath 1,105-square-foot East Village condo.
Asking Price: $1.245 million.
Charges and Taxes: $670 per month.
Agent: Jason Walker, Prudential Douglas Elliman.

Given that it’s home to a guy who’s one of the biggest stars in R&B, this East Village condo in a renovated tenement building is surprisingly modest. But John Legend, the Ivy League–educated, Grammy-winning, Obama-supporting heartthrob in question, bought the place in 2005, just after his album Get Lifted took off, and has stuck around ever since. He’s done a thorough and very sleek renovation of the apartment, but that can’t make it any bigger. And, says his broker, Jason Walker, Legend is looking for more space—maybe, he jokes, enough space for a grand piano instead of the current upright. “He’s ready to try out something a little different,” says Walker, who describes the singer-pianist as “down-to-earth.” He also adds that Legend wants a big open kitchen “where he can interact with other people while he’s cooking,” says Walker. He composes and cooks? No wonder the girls love him.
